Zusammenfassung: | Introduction: There is an increasing number of people diagnosed with some type of food allergy or intolerance. Objective: To characterize adverse food reactions (RAA) in children assisted by the National School Feeding Program. Materials and methods: It is a descriptive, prospective, transversal and quantitative research. The sample consisted of 44 children diagnosed with some type of adverse food reaction, both sexes, aged 2 to 9 years, from the municipal school system of Montes Claros-MG. Nutritional status was diagnosed using anthropometric indices, in addition to a questionnaire on the child's quality of life, answered by mothers and medical reports were analyzed. Results: There was a higher prevalence of children with only one adverse food reaction (63.3%). Lactose intolerance was the most evident type of RAA (31.9%), followed by milk protein allergy, and egg allergy. Regarding the children's quality of life, the general condition was considered mostly good (34.1%) and very good (27.3), and a large part claimed health improvement after confirmation of the diagnosis. In relation to quality of life, interferences in the social relations of children with family, friends and at school were verified. Conclusion: Adverse reactions related to milk were the most frequent. Most children were within normal limits, considering the anthropometric parameters analyzed. The quality of life of the child and parents suffers significant influences due to the reactions, interfering in the relationships between school and family social activities of the child.
